Resultados de la búsqueda a petición "ienumerable"

2 la respuesta

¿Por qué no puedo usar el enumerador de una matriz, en lugar de implementarlo yo mismo?

Tengo un código como este: public class EffectValues : IEnumerable<object> { public object [ ] Values { get; set; } public IEnumerator<object> GetEnumerator ( ) { return this.Values.GetEnumerator ( ); } ...

2 la respuesta

¿Por qué XmlSerializer requiere tipos que heredan de IEnumerable para tener una implementación de Add (System.Object)?

Estoy usando la serialización xml pero ahora me encontré con un error de tiempo de ejecución que no había visto antes. "Para ser serializable en XML, los tipos que heredan de IEnumerable deben tener una implementación de Add (System.Object) en ...

2 la respuesta

IEnumerable <T> Extensión de fusión nula

on frecuencia me enfrento al problema para verificar si unIEnumerable<T> es nulo antes de iterar sobre él a través de consultas foreach o LINQ, luego a menudo aparece en códigos como este: var myProjection = (myList ?? ...

2 la respuesta

Resharper: Posible enumeración múltiple de IEnumerable

Estoy usando la nueva versión 6. de Resharper. En varios lugares de mi código, ha subrayado algunos textos y me ha advertido que puede haber un Posible enumeración múltiple de IEnumerable. Entiendo lo que esto significa, y he tomado el consejo ...

2 la respuesta

¿Hace Foreach Cache IEnumerable?

Suponiendo esoSomeMethod tiene firma public IEnumerable<T> SomeMethod<T>(); hay alguna diferencia entre foreach (T tmp in SomeMethod<T>()) { ... } IEnumerable<T> result = SomeMethod<T>(); foreach (T tmp in result) { ... }n otras palabras, los ...

2 la respuesta

C # foreach en IEnumerable vs. List - modificación del elemento persistente solo para la matriz - ¿Por qué?

En C #, he notado que si estoy ejecutando un bucle foreach en un LINQ generadoIEnumerable<T> colección e intento modificar el contenido de cada elemento T, mis modificacionesno so persistente Por otro lado, si aplico laToArray() oToList() ...

2 la respuesta

Gráfico de equivalentes IEnumerable LINQ en Scala? [duplicar

Posible duplicado: LINQ análogos en Scala [https://stackoverflow.com/questions/3785413/linq-analogues-in-scala] Estoy buscando un gráfico que muestre equivalentes en los métodos Scala de LINQ para IEnumerable: Primero es cabezaSeleccionar es ...

3 la respuesta

¿Es posible extender matrices en C #?

3 la respuesta

¿Por qué hay dos versiones completamente diferentes de Reverse for List e IEnumerable?

3 la respuesta

¿Existe una implementación IEnumerable que solo itere sobre su origen (por ejemplo, LINQ) una vez?

Previsto